Daniel Defense "mk12"
(18 CHF Stainless Barrel 1/7 twist, rifle gas)
Magpul MOE+ grip
BCM mod 3 Charging handle
B5 Sopmod stock
Geissele SSA trigger
Padded VCAS 2 point sling
Knights Armament micro 600m BUIS
Atlas Bipods
Bobro dual throw 30mm mount
Nightforce NXS 2.5-10X42

added the XPS 2-0. took it out to sight it in and it was very easy. i love the reticle. i didn't think i would, because it's very small. using this sight is almost like cheating, but i say use every advantage you can get. i think it's actually better than a laser sight. i also like the ability to increase/decrease the brightness for any lighting situation. $450 at Sport Optic. Built on a Spikes Tactical Crusader lower. Surefire break, 16" barrel, 15" Midwest industries free-floating forearm, now sporting the Sharps Rifle Company reliabolt BCG, JP Silent Capture, ergo grip, skeleton butt stock, mega arms adjustable trigger, laser engraving, cerakote, internals polished so it's about as quiet as can be, off set iron sights with a 1.5X5 Leopold VX III.

I just installed a new "pinless" dust cover and it is great, no more having to take the forearm off or fiddling around with those small E clips.
